Patent number: 8170895Abstract: A computer assisted method includes selecting a sample of accounts from a historical database of accounts corresponding to deceased debtors, The sample indicates whether or not an estate was found for each deceased debtor. A comprehensive set of credit related variables corresponding to the accounts is obtained from a first source. A comprehensive set of demographic related variables corresponding to the accounts is obtained from a second source. The variables are mapped to the accounts and a computer executable model is created by identifying a subset of variables from the sets of variables and using the subset of variables and sample of accounts such that the model provides a prediction of whether or not an estate exists for a given deceased debtor.Type: GrantFiled: January 16, 2009Date of Patent: May 1, 2012Assignee: Forte LLCInventor: Andrew M. Larsen

Publication number: 20120095891Abstract: Various embodiments include at least one of systems, methods, and software for probate claim identification and merging. One such embodiment includes processing, utilizing a computer processor, debtor account records stored in an account database to match debtor account records with probate estate records stored in a probate estate database. Upon identification of a match of a debtor account record with a probate estate record, the debtor account record may be associated with the probate estate record. Subsequently a claims process may be executed to generate claims against probate estates. Generating such a claim, when two or more accounts are identified for a single debtor, may consist of generating a single claim against the probate estate of the debtor. The single claim is for each of a plurality of accounts of the debtor of a particular client.Type: ApplicationFiled: October 18, 2010Publication date: April 19, 2012Applicant: FORTE LLCInventors: Angela Marie Horn, Dereck John Eastman

Patent number: 7890435Abstract: Systems and method to identify and locate probate estates of client debtors. One embodiment includes receiving a client file, wherein the file includes a record of individual client debtors and determining if a date of death is available for each of the individual client debtors. Some such embodiments further include identifying one or more courts in which to search for a probate estate for each of the individual client debtors and searching for a probate estate in each identified court for each respective client debtor. In some embodiments, if a probate estate is not identified for a client debtor, the client debtor is placed in a queue, and the search is performed on a recurring or periodic basis until the probate estate is located or a certain period of time has passed.Type: GrantFiled: August 27, 2010Date of Patent: February 15, 2011Assignee: Forte, LLCInventor: James A. Balogh
